Saeed Saeed

Saeed Saeed

Journalist
Abu Dhabi
Saeed is a features writer for The National, reporting on all things arts and culture happening in the UAE and internationally. With a focus on music and Arabic pop culture, Saeed has interviewed some of the biggest singers in the region and the world. Born in Abu Dhabi, Saeed lived in the UAE until he was nine, before moving to Melbourne, Australia, where, in addition to his journalism, he worked as a security guard, youth worker and video-store clerk. He returned to the city of his birth in 2011 to work for The National. Saeed continues to be amazed at the city’s cultural development and expansion.
